Environmental Law

question
Societal norms
answer
reflection of the society
question

Statute

answer
a written law passed by a legislative body
question
regulation
answer
a rule or directive made and maintained by an authority/ agency. (EPA, OSHA)
question
Common Law
answer
A legal system based on custom and court rulings
question
What are examples of law
answer

1. Societal norms

2. Statute/ code

3. regulation

4.judicial decision

5. Common law

6. Constitutions

7. Agency decisions permits

8. Administrative law

question
Administrative law
answer

regulation, agency decisions and permits, and judicial decision

question
where to find eLAW
answer

1. United states code

2. Code of federal regulations

3. Federal register

4. judicial reports (cases)

question
Explain the gov't structure
answer

1. Three branches (legislative, executive and judical)

2. level (federal, state, and local)

question
explain the legislative branch
answer
The legislative branch is a branch of the government that has the power to make laws.
question
explain the executive branch
answer
The executive branch is a branch of the government that is in charge with the execution and enforcement of laws and policies and the administration of public affairs.
question

explain the judicial branch

answer
Interprets the laws and resolve conflicts
question
1. What is the primary source of authority of government agencies?
answer
The legislature is the main source of power of an administrative agency. Administrative agencies only carry the powers conferred upon them either by the statute or the constitution.
question
What is a regulatory taking?
answer
A government regulation that infringes upon private property ownership to such an extent that the regulation can be considered a taking, thus requiring just compensation.
question

What are some constitutional limit of govt authority?

answer

1. No law may violate the U.S constitution

2. No federal ELAW must have basis the U.S constitution

3. regulatory takings

question
Regulations/Rules
answer
limitations or restrictions on the activities of a business or individual
question
Administrative Law
answer
The body of law created by administrative agencies (in the form of rules, regulations, orders, and decisions) in order to carry out their duties and responsibilities.
question
what are problems of administrative law
answer

1. potential for agency capture

2. scientific uncertainty

3. Cost - benefit analysis

question
Judicial Review
answer
Allows the court to determine the constitutionality of laws
question
standing
answer
a legal rule stating who is authorized to start a lawsuit
question

What are example case of APA right to Judicial review

answer
Overton park case
question

what cases are example of standing?

answer

1. sierra club vs morton case

2. Lujan case

question
Delegation Doctrine
answer
A doctrine based on the U.S. Constitution, which has been construed to allow Congress to delegate some of its power to administrative agencies to make and implement laws.
question

What are the three factors that a person can challenge an agency decision in court

answer

1. Administrative Procedure Act (APA) right of judicial review

2. Statutory citizen’s suit provision (e.g. – ESA, CWA)

Standing

question
3 part reasoning in whether to decide if the plaintiff ha standing
answer

1. injury in fact

2. causation

3. redressable

question

NEPA

answer
National Environmental Policy Act
question

categorical exclusion

answer

question

EIS

answer

environmental impact statement

question

EIS requirements

answer

- Timing

- Publish notice of intent in federal register

- Public comment

- Scoping – planning phrase at the beginning of EIS (who would be involved)

- Public comment

- Lead agency

- Draft EIS

- Final EIS

- ROD (record of Decision)

- Analysis of envir impacts

question
3 factors from the lujan case
answer

1. injury

2. causation

3. Redressable

question
Biodiversity
answer
the variety of life in the world or in a particular habitat or ecosystem.
question
3 levels of biodiversity
answer
genetic, species, ecosystem
question
esa
answer
endangered species act
question
Three things that happen when a species is listed
answer

1. designate critical habitat

2. impact of critical habitat designation

3. recovery

question
TVA vs. Hill (1978)
answer

Facts: building a dam at tellico

reasoning: yes, section 7 esa clearly requires it

question

2 phrases of the ESA act

answer

1. substantive vs procedural statute

2. section 7
